DESCRIPTION
The NEB has three small units (Financial Management, Financial Reporting and Accounting Operations) within the Financial Services Team responsible for the NEB’s financial management as well as central agency compliance requirements. Two groups are led by a Group Leader, while the third is led by the Director who oversees the entire Team. The mixture of personnel on the team includes: clerical/data entry staff, financial analytical staff, and a technical specialist. Non-baseline workload requirements for the Financial Services Team has been and continues to be at a level where current resources cannot support the workload requirements. Specific project details/resources are not clearly known at this time.

EVALUATION PROCESS AND SELECTION METHODOLOGY
Basis of Selection - Highest Combined Rating of Technical Merit (60%) and Price (40%)
To be declared responsive, a bid must:
comply with all the requirements of the bid solicitation;
meet all the mandatory evaluation criteria; and
obtain the required minimum number of points specified in Attachment 1 to Part 4 for the point rated technical criteria.
The responsive bid with the highest combined rating of technical merit and price will be recommended for award of a contract. In the event two or more responsive bids have the same highest combined rating of technical merit and price, the responsive bid that obtained the highest overall score for all the point rated technical criteria will be recommended for award of a contract.
